Llapanhuyo
Llapanhuyo is a locality in Cayarani District, Condesuyos Province, Arequipa and has about 1 residents and an elevation of 4,580 metres. Llapanhuyo is situated nearby to the hamlet Apacheta, as well as near Pullhuay.Places of Interest

Tanka
Peak
Tanka is a 4,783-metre-high mountain in the Andes of Peru. It is situated in the Arequipa Region, Condesuyos Province, Cayarani District, in the southern extensions of the Wansu mountain range. Tanka lies at the Puma Ranra valley, south of Allqa Q'awa.
